Wire Transfer Clerk processes the electronic transfer of funds for customers. Prepares and processes all documents required for each transaction. Being a Wire Transfer Clerk inputs transactions into applicable systems, maintains records of transfer procedures and reconciles all accounts. Documents and resolves any customer issues. Additionally, Wire Transfer Clerk may require an associate degree.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. The Wire Transfer Clerk works under moderate supervision. Gaining or has attained full proficiency in a specific area of discipline. To be a Wire Transfer Clerk typically requires 1-3 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Founded in 1994, International Money Express (NASDAQ: IMXI) is a leading omnichannel provider of money transfer services. Focused on excellence, we always strive to provide unsurpassed quality and customer service, making the whole process quicker, easier, and more secure. Offering the digital movement of money through proprietary technology, a network of more than 100,000 payer locations, company-operated stores, our mobile app, and the company website, we enable consumers to send money from the United States and Canada to 17 countries, including Latin America, Africa, Asia, and now Europe.
